Gebhart Heads West For Dual PD Role
Josh (JAY JAY) Gebhart is the new Program Director for Hot AC station KEHK-FM/Eugene, OR, (Star 102.3). He will also serve as PD for Oregon’s Willamette Valley Hits Radio station KSCR (1320 AM/98.1 FM).

Consumers Still Turn To TV For News
The Pew Research Center is out with its latest study on how Americans consume news. 47% of Americans prefer watching the news rather than reading (34%) or listening (19%) to it. Radio is up slightly from Pew's 2016 study.
Denver Listeners Decide Song Is Not Offensive
KOSI-FM in Denver is owned by Bonneville. PD Jim Lawson says listeners to his radio station have voted overwhelmingly to put "Baby It's Cold Outside" back on the radio. And, the station has done so.
Beasley Quietly Unveils Podcast Network
It's called bPodStudios and there are already 45 podcasts in the network. There's on-demand radio shows from the likes of Preston & Steve, Dave & Chuck, and other Beasley radio hosts, as well as original podcasts.
Mohn Stepping Down As NPR Boss
NPR President and CEO Jarl Mohn announced on Tuesday that he will be stepping down when his five-year contract expires on June 30, 2019. Mohr will be given the title of President Emeritus.
Chubb & SiMan Go National
Chubb Rock Afternoons with SiMan Baby, a daily show hosted by Hip Hop icon Chubb Rock and Atlanta radio legend SiMan Baby, is going into syndication. The Atlanta-based, four-hour PM-drive program will air live via XDS Monday-Friday, 3 p.m.-7 p.m. ET.
